Output 59d0e80768d4efbf9ab898fc1d5645599a696f6b53e745f9dbf6ec153c0a7562:3

value
13271401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73673aa4d8ce69fbfca472d2b912f5bb544ca5d0 OP_EQUAL
address
3CDDJ5xeXf1TwQAzm5hMy2JoYR86NTgoQ2
transaction
59d0e80768d4efbf9ab898fc1d5645599a696f6b53e745f9dbf6ec153c0a7562
spent
true